#include using namespace std; using ll =long long; #define all(v) v.begin(),v.end() #define rep(i,a,b) for(int i=a;i=b;i--) void solve() { ll N,M;cin>>N>>M; vector A(N+1); A[0]=M; for(ll i=1;i<=N;i++) cin>>A[i]; vector a(N+1),b(N+1); a[1]=A[1]; b[1]=0; for(ll i=2;i<=N;i++) { b[i]=A[i-2]-a[i-1]; a[i]=A[i]-b[i]; if(b[i]<0||a[i]<0) { cout<<"No"<>t; for(ll i=0;i